Description
Positioned at the end of a cul de sac of just four homes we are delighted to be offering for sale this substantial detached home. The home has been much improved and extended by the current owners to provide a truly versatile family home, perfectly suited for both single and multi-generational living. The main house is blessed with three excellent reception rooms. A large double aspect sitting room, dining room, and breakfast room with bay window overlooking the garden. The kitchen is recently re-fitted to a very high standard and has an adjoining utility room and a simply brilliant walk-in larder.
Upstairs there is a spacious landing which gives access to four double bedrooms all with fitted wardrobes. The master bedroom has a stunning ensuite shower room that was fully re-fitted in 2023. There is a further shower room that was also refitted to the same high standard in 2023.
In addition to the main house the current owners have extended to create a superb additional ground floor apartment. This is a truly versatile space and comprises a large double bedroom, shower room, and kitchen living room with vaulted ceiling with bi-fold doors out to the garden. The apartment has been designed for ease of movement and is fully connected to the main house.
Outside to the front, the large resin driveway provides ample parking for several cars. There is also detached double car port, The rear garden is delightful and very private. There are patio areas to the rear of the main house and the apartment making the most of the southerly aspect as well as areas of lawn and mature flowering borders.
Romsey, a delightful old market town has retained much of its original character and provides an excellent range of amenities for everyday needs. Facilities include a range of individual shops, schools, leisure facilities, doctors and dentist surgeries and public transport by way of bus and rail services. The M27 can be accessed at junction 3, about 3 ½ miles distant. The major centres of Salisbury, Southampton, Winchester and Portsmouth are all easily accessed.
